slave switchover Syntax
slave switchover
View
User view
Parameter
None
Description
Use the slave switchover command to perform manual switchover on
master/slave system.
The user can use this command to perform master/slave switchover. The
master/slave switchover can be performed only when the slave board operates
normally and the switchover is enabled. The master/slave switchover can be
performed only when the slave board enters real-time backup status. Master/slave
switchover does not affect the normal operation of other board. When the
master/slave switchover is performed, the user is required to confirm before the
master control system sends bus switchover command to the backup system.
After correct confirmation, this command can be executed. This command can be
executed only after correct confirmation.
Example
Enable master/slave switchover manually.
<SW7700>slave switchover
Caution!!! Confirm switch slave to master[Y/N]?y
Starting.....
RAM Line....OK
